    What makes it pointless? I'm facing a main seal replacement...I think.

     

    Factory-installed rear main seals on those engines hardly leak, ever. 1 out of 200 maybe? If not smaller odds than that. I put the new one in literally perfectly flush, like a textbook installation…. and it started showing wetness less than 10k miles later. My friend that did engine work at Subaru for 4 years replaced the one on his own car and it started to leak lol. The factory-installed one on my car had over 150k miles on it and wasn’t leaking before I took it out. Rear main seals are only worth replacing on engines that are known to have rear main leaks because seal replacement is sometimes a roll of the dice. I would check your car from the highest point to its lowest point to verify its not leaking from another point, unless your seal has been replaced in the past.

  5. My pump works fine. It’ll probably still squeal though from air in the system. When I last had that problem found it was drawing air in through the washer on this bolt: spacer.png

     

    Replace the washer on the bolt. I have a new one in the bag of hardware you have. Torque it to spec and then go a little tighter on it after that. It ended up fixing it. Then bleed the PS system really well and drive it. May have to drive it a little with the cap off if it still whines. I might have had P0107 before and I think it ended up going away once the car was being driven. Since it’s a stored code I would drive the car for a while and see if it goes away. If the P1507 is a pending code which it looks like it is, it can be from an exhaust leak or out of adjustment valves if it’s not the actual switch itself. If the switch doesn’t fix it hook it up to a smoke machine. This has fixed that problem on this car in the past.

  12. You want to look into JDM springs and not USDM springs (you are on a usdm forum). Reason I say this is because the shocks you have have different valving and different heights on the perches in the rear than the USDM cars. The best springs for a wagon that are usdm are H&R springs and they will probably be okay for your wagon but try to find jdm springs for a wagon first because they will fit better. I’m probably tried more lowering springs on this chassis than most members.

    Yes. Pull the damn engine. You're going to have a lot of trouble properly torquing the head bolts with the block still in the car... and that means you're just going to have to redo this job in 6 months.

     

    That’s not true just follow the torque sequence and then rotate each bolt approximately 180 degrees in the procedure that’s asked for. If he follows the procedure torquing heads in car is 100% fine. Dealership heavy line techs have done it that way before. You’re speaking to one.

     

    The sand paper to head surface is what he needs to worry about. Goes without saying heads need machining or else it’s not going to last. Wd40 with razer blade and scotchbrite pads will be fine for the block side....
